Assertion : If any piece of DNA is somehow transferred into an alien organism,, most likely, this piece of DNA would not be able to multiple itself in the progeny cells of the organism
Reason :For the multiplication of any alien piece of DNA in an organism it needs to be a part of a chromosome (s) which has a specific sequence known as origin of replication.

A

If both assertion and reason are true and the reason is the correct explanation of the assertion

B

If both assertion and reason are true but reason is not the correct explanation of the assertion

C

If assertion is true but reason is false

D

If both assertion and reason are false

Text Solution

AI Generated Solution

The correct Answer is:
### Step-by-Step Solution: 1. **Understanding the Assertion**: The assertion states that if a piece of DNA is transferred into an alien organism, it is unlikely that this DNA will replicate in the progeny cells of that organism. This suggests that foreign DNA may not be compatible with the host's cellular machinery. 2. **Understanding the Reason**: The reason provided explains that for any DNA to replicate within an organism, it must be integrated into the organism's chromosomes. Specifically, it needs to have a sequence known as the "origin of replication" (ori site), which is essential for the initiation of DNA replication. 3. **Linking Assertion and Reason**: The assertion aligns with the reason because if the foreign DNA does not integrate into the host's chromosomes or lacks an origin of replication, it cannot be replicated during cell division. Thus, the assertion is supported by the reason. 4. **Evaluating the Truth of Both Statements**: Both the assertion and the reason are true. The assertion correctly identifies the limitation of foreign DNA replication, and the reason accurately describes the necessity of the origin of replication for DNA multiplication. 5. **Conclusion**: Since both the assertion and the reason are true, and the reason provides a correct explanation for the assertion, the answer is that both statements are true, and the reason is the correct explanation of the assertion. ### Final Answer: Both assertion and reason are true, and the reason is the correct explanation of the assertion.
